Report Title:
Real Property; Leasehold
Description:
Due to the economic emergency affecting the State of Hawaii, places a temporary moratorium on all commercial, retail, and industrial lease rent increases, including annual or periodic rent step-ups already negotiated, commencing on , and ending December 31, 2010. (HB1601 HD1)

A BILL FOR AN ACT
RELATING TO REAL PROPERTY.
BE IT ENACTED BY THE LEGISLATURE OF THE STATE OF HAWAII:
SECTION 1. Due to the economic emergency affecting the State of Hawaii, there shall be a temporary moratorium on all commercial, retail, and industrial lease rent increases, including annual or periodic rent step-ups already negotiated, for the period commencing on , and ending on December 31, 2010. The term "rent" shall not include additions to rent such as pro-rata maintenance fees, pro-rata operating expenses, real property taxes, utilities, chill water charges, Hawaii general excise tax, and any other expense that would constitute a reimbursement of costs to the lessor. This moratorium does not affect the lessor's right to terminate the lease or to pursue summary possession or collection of a debt arising from a lessee's default for non-payment of rent and charges payable under this moratorium, nor does it affect a lessor's rights and remedies under the lease for breach of a non-monetary default, all such rights and remedies are not affected by this legislation.
SECTION 2. This Act shall take effect upon its approval.
